Natasha Denona Mini Zendo Eyeshadow Palette
“Introducing the NEW MINI ZENDO Eyeshadow Palette !
A warm-toned palette that conceptualizes a mix of elements – an ambiance where wood meets metal & nature meets modern.
Features 5 highly pigmented shades, including Dusty Coral, Pastel Pinks, a Deep Cool Burgundy and a Light Taupe – Perfect to create neutral, all-flattering looks with a pop of color!“
The Natasha Denona Mini Zendo Eyeshadow Palette is one product within the Natasha Denona Holiday Collection which is being revealed product by product on the Natasha Denona Instagram page.
Shades
- Stark – medium-dark cool burgundy
- Bare – pastel pink
- Stripped – warm silver
- Dazz – medium coral with light bronze shift
- Uncovered – dusty coral
